From Apprentice to Owner
I'm David Rumpel, owner of Timberline Plumbing. If you call or fill out a form on this site, I'm the one who actually sees it — not a dispatcher, not a call center.
I started in this trade from the bottom, as an apprentice on a 256-unit, 55-and-over apartment complex in Smokey Point, Arlington. I learned by paying attention — listening to the plumbers around me who'd been doing this far longer than I had, and applying what I picked up every day on the job. That's still how I run things now: pay attention, do it right, and don't cut a corner just because no one would notice right away.
Timberline Plumbing is the new name for what was Seattle's Plumbing LLC — same license, same standards, and a brand built around how I actually want to run this business: quality over quantity, not volume over care.

Licensed, Certified, and Held to a Higher Standard
Commercial Plumbing License
Qualifies me to work on large-scale commercial projects, restaurants, and public works, not just residential homes — even though residential is where Timberline Plumbing focuses.
Certified Navien Tankless Technician

Ongoing Code Education
Regular continuing-education and code-update courses alongside local and state inspectors, so the work reflects current Washington plumbing code — not just "up to code when it was installed."
